Risotto Milanese

Rich, luxurious, and vibrantly golden, Risotto Milanese is the quintessential Italian comfort food that brings elegance to your dining table. This classic Milanese recipe showcases creamy Arborio rice infused with the delicate allure of saffron, creating its unmistakable golden hue and subtle earthy flavor. Simmered to perfection with warm chicken or vegetable stock, dry white wine, and sautéed shallots, this dish achieves a luscious, velvety texture that melts in your mouth. Finished with a generous swirl of butter and freshly grated Parmesan cheese, this risotto becomes a masterpiece of flavor and comfort. Ideal as a refined side dish or a stand-alone meal, Risotto Milanese is a celebration of simple ingredients elevated to gourmet status. Perfectly suited for dinner parties, special occasions, or cozy nights in, this saffron risotto is a timeless addition to your culinary repertoire.

Prep Time:10 mins
Cook Time:30 mins
Total Time:40 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 300 g Arborio rice
  • 1 litre Chicken or vegetable stock
  • 60 g Unsalted butter
  • 2 tbsp Olive oil
  • 2 small Shallots
  • 120 ml Dry white wine
  • 1 pinch Saffron strands
  • 60 g Grated Parmesan cheese
  • 0 to taste Salt
  • 0 to taste Black pepper

Directions

Step 1

In a medium saucepan, heat the chicken or vegetable stock over low heat and keep it warm throughout the cooking process.

Step 2

In a small bowl, combine the saffron strands with 2 tablespoons of the warm stock and let it steep for at least 5 minutes.

Step 3

Finely dice the shallots and prepare all other ingredients so they are ready to use.

Step 4

Heat 30g of the butter and 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large, heavy-bottomed saucepan over medium heat.

Step 5

Add the diced shallots to the pan and sauté for 2–3 minutes until soft and translucent but not browned.

Step 6

Add the Arborio rice to the pan and stir well for 1–2 minutes until coated in the butter and oil mixture and lightly toasted.

Step 7

Pour in the white wine and stir continuously until the liquid has completely evaporated.

Step 8

Add one ladleful of the warm stock to the rice and stir gently until it is mostly absorbed.

Step 9

Continue adding the stock one ladleful at a time, stirring regularly and allowing each addition to be absorbed before adding the next. This process should take about 20 minutes.

Step 10

Halfway through the cooking process, stir in the saffron mixture along with its liquid to infuse the risotto with its characteristic color and flavor.

Step 11

Once the rice is cooked to al dente and the risotto has a creamy consistency, remove the pan from the heat.

Step 12

Stir in the remaining 30g of butter and the grated Parmesan cheese until melted and fully incorporated.

Step 13

Season with salt and black pepper to taste, then cover the pan and let the risotto rest for 2 minutes before serving.

Step 14

Serve the Risotto Milanese hot, garnished with additional Parmesan cheese if desired.
